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99102332891 6173146390 909
8360930 60523 44025
8360930 60523 44025
070909678 802 6345 760 9911023
All about undefined
Interested in learning more?
8360930 60523 44025
070909678 802 6345 760 9911023
See more
826968465 06 920344109
18615946523 0223 70916208273
See more
634022683 3808675
844276 096 118071455
See more